Erling Haaland apologised to Moldova keeper Cristian Avram after scoring five in Norway’s 11โ€“1 World Cup qualifying win.

Cristian Avram, the 31-year-old goalkeeper for the Republic of Moldova’s national team, recounted his conversation with Norway’s top scorer, Erling Haaland, after their public thrashing in Oslo (1-11).

Avram had already picked the ball out of his net twice within just 11 minutes, and by halftime, he had conceded five goals. Erling Haaland bagged a hat-trick and provided the assist for Myhre’s opening goal.

Six more goals followed in the second half, including two additional strikes from the Manchester City forward, plus a four-goal haul from substitute Asgaard of Glasgow Rangers in just 25 minutes.

“Haaland felt somewhat bad for us, but he played to score as much as possible because his team wants to win the group,” said the Araz-Nakhchivan goalkeeper.

At the end of the nightmare match, Cristian Avram found the strength to speak with his tormentor at Ulevaal Stadion. “Hello, I’m Moldova’s goalkeeper, and I conceded 11 goals,” he began his testimony during an interview with Norwegian broadcaster TV2.

“I spoke with Erling. He told me, ‘It’s not my fault,’ and that he had to keep trying to score because they needed the biggest possible goal difference. I understand him; it’s part of the game. He wanted to keep fighting.”

Erling Haaland’s five goals represent his personal best for the national team and the highest number of goals scored by a European player in a World Cup qualifying match since Hans Krankl’s six goals for Austria in 1977.

Avram had the chance to avoid another thrashing suffered by Moldova against Norway in March (0-5) in the 2026 World Cup qualifying group. On that occasion, Celeadnic was in goal, beaten only once each by Haaland and Asgaard.
